Family and friends must say goodbye to their beloved Thomas Daniel Crimmins (Irvington, New York), born in New York, New York, who passed away, on April 24, 2020. He was predeceased by: his parents, Margaret Crimmins and Daniel Crimmins; and his siblings, James, Margaret, Elizabeth and Theresa.

He is survived by: his wife Pat; his children, Karen (Michael O'Rourke), Kevin (Jackie) and Thomas (Robyn); his grandchildren, Kyle, Jack, Gavin, Courtney, Logan and Mackenzie; and his sister Dorothy. He is also survived by nieces and nephews.

Due to the COVID-19 pandemic, a private burial service will be held for family.

Memorial contributions may be made in his memory to St. Jude's.
